Front turn signal lights
Turn the steering wheel in the
opposite direction of the light to
be replaced.
Turn the steering wheel to a point
that allows your hand to easily fit
between the tire and fender liner.
Remove the clips and partly
remove the fender liner.
To prevent damage to the vehicle,
cover the tip of the screwdriver
with a rag.

Front fog lights (vehicles with discharge headlights)
Turn the steering wheel in the
opposite direction of the light to
be replaced.
Turn the steering wheel to a point
that allows your hand to easily fit
between the tire and fender liner.
Remove the clips and partly
remove the fender liner.
To prevent damage to the vehicle,
cover the tip of the screwdriver
with a rag.
Unplug the connector while
depressing the lock release.
